清晨的阳光透过窗帘洒进房间,桌上的咖啡杯里还冒着热气。屏幕前的交易员小李正盯着一排密密麻麻的数据图表,眉头紧锁。他最近开发的一款期货交易EA(Expert Advisor)表现平平,虽然实现了自动化操作,但收益波动较大,甚至一度出现了亏损。这让他陷入了深深的思考——为什么明明技术看起来无懈可击,实际运行却总是不尽如人意?

这个问题并非孤例。随着量化交易的普及,越来越多投资者选择借助EA来实现自动化决策。然而,如何让这些“聪明”的程序真正“聪明”起来,依然是许多交易者面临的难题。今天,我们就从几个关键维度入手,探讨如何优化期货交易EA,让它成为助力盈利而非制造麻烦的得力助手。

1. 数据质量决定成败

如果你问EA最需要什么养分,答案只有一个——高质量的数据。很多初学者往往忽略这一点,直接下载公开数据源就开始回测。殊不知,数据延迟、错误或者不完整都会严重影响EA的表现。例如,在高频交易中,毫秒级别的偏差可能就会导致重大损失。

因此,优化的第一步就是确保你的数据源足够可靠。可以选择付费的专业级数据服务提供商,比如彭博、路透社等,它们提供的历史数据和实时行情不仅精确度高,而且覆盖范围广。此外,还可以利用API接口抓取更深层次的信息,比如市场情绪指标、宏观经济数据等,帮助EA更好地理解市场脉络。

画面感描述 想象一下,数据就像建筑的地基。如果地基松散,哪怕盖起再宏伟的大厦,也难逃倒塌的命运。而优质的数据库则是坚实的基础,为EA提供了准确的输入信号,从而保证后续决策的可靠性。

2. 参数调优的艺术

参数调优是EA优化的核心环节之一。每个EA都有自己的参数设置,比如止损点位、止盈比例、持仓时间等。然而,盲目调整参数可能导致过拟合现象,即EA只对特定历史数据有效,而无法应对未知的市场变化。

为了规避这一问题,建议采用“网格搜索法”或“遗传算法”等科学方法进行参数优化。这种方法通过对大量参数组合进行模拟测试,筛选出既能适应多种市场环境,又具备稳定盈利能力的最佳配置方案。同时,要避免过度依赖单一指标(如最大回撤率),而是综合考虑多个维度,比如胜率、收益率曲线平滑度以及资金使用效率。

情感渲染 试想一下,当EA终于找到了那个完美的参数组合时,那种成就感简直难以言表。就像一位棋手经过无数次练习,最终悟出了制胜之道,而这份智慧将转化为持续稳定的盈利。

3. 风控机制的重要性

风控永远是交易的灵魂所在。即使是最优秀的EA,也无法完全避免市场的不确定性。因此,建立完善的风控体系至关重要。例如,设置动态仓位管理规则,根据当前账户权益动态调整单笔交易规模;引入多重止损策略,防止因突发事件导致巨额亏损。

另外,还可以尝试引入“压力测试”功能。通过模拟极端行情(如黑天鹅事件),评估EA在高风险条件下的表现,并据此做出改进。这种未雨绸缪的做法能够大幅降低意外情况带来的冲击。

批判性思维 尽管风控措施可以降低风险,但也可能牺牲部分潜在收益。因此,在设计风控机制时,必须找到风险控制与收益追求之间的平衡点。过于保守可能会错失良机,而过于激进则容易酿成灾难。

4. 心理因素的隐形影响

很多人忽视了一个事实:EA的行为背后,其实隐藏着开发者的心理特质。比如,某些开发者倾向于追求短期暴利,因此会设计出激进型的策略;而另一些人则偏好稳健增长,所以会选择保守型的配置。这些潜意识的选择,往往会影响最终的结果。

因此,优化EA的过程中,也需要对自身的投资理念进行反思。问问自己:你是希望每年获取稳定的低回报,还是愿意承担一定风险换取更高的收益?只有明确了自己的目标,才能指导EA朝着正确的方向发展。

观点提炼 EA本质上是人类智慧的延伸,但它并不能代替人类的判断力。真正的成功,离不开理性分析与感性洞察的有机结合。

5. 持续迭代与学习

最后一点也是最重要的一点:EA不是一次性工程,而是需要不断迭代优化的过程。市场总是在变化,今天的最优解未必适合明天。因此,定期复盘EA的表现,并根据最新市场动态进行调整,是必不可少的工作。

此外,还可以借鉴其他优秀交易者的经验。加入社区交流群组,与其他开发者分享心得,甚至合作开发新的模块。这种开放的态度会让你的EA始终保持活力。

结尾升华 优化期货交易EA的过程,既是一场技术的较量,也是一次内心的修行。它教会我们如何面对复杂多变的世界,如何在不确定中寻找确定性。正如一位哲人所说:“成功的秘诀在于坚持和学习。”当你看到EA为你带来稳定收益的时候,你会发现,这一切努力都是值得的。

标题虽简短,但背后的意义深远。愿每位交易者都能通过不断探索与实践,找到属于自己的那片蓝海。